概括
本研究介绍了CoRE学习,将时间共享和资源调度整合到智能超级计算的机器学习理论中. 这种新的方法优化了用于高级AI开发的计算资源配置.

背景情况:
- 智能超级计算设施需要高效的资源管理来进行复杂的计算.
- 机器学习理论在历史上忽视了这些环境中资源调度的复杂性.
研究的目的:
- 引入CoRE-learning,这是一个新的机器学习框架.
- 将时间共享和资源调度概念整合到机器学习理论中.
- 提高智能超级计算设施的效率.
主要方法:
- 发展CORE学习框架.
- 将时间共享原则纳入机器学习算法.
- 在学习过程中实施资源调度机制.
主要成果:
- CoRE学习成功地将时间共享和资源调度集成到机器学习中.
- 该框架为超级计算中的资源管理提供了一个新的理论基础.
- 证明了优化计算任务分配的潜力.
结论:
- CoRE学习代表了超级计算机器学习理论的重大进步.
- 提出的方法为高效利用智能计算资源提供了一个新的范式.
- 未来的工作可以探索实际实施和绩效基准.

Parallel Processing
145
The brain processes sensory information rapidly due to parallel processing, which involves sending data across multiple neural pathways at the same time. This method allows the brain to manage various sensory qualities, such as shapes, colors, movements, and locations, all concurrently. For instance, when observing a forest landscape, the brain simultaneously processes the movement of leaves, the shapes of trees, the depth between them, and the various shades of green. Associative Learning
309
Associative learning is a fundamental concept in behavioral psychology, wherein a connection is established between two stimuli or events, leading to a learned response. This process is critical in understanding how behaviors are acquired and modified. Conditioning, the mechanism through which associations are formed, can be divided into two main types: classical conditioning and operant conditioning, each elucidating different aspects of associative learning.
